How to Repair Patio Furniture Straps

Patio furniture is a great way to relax and enjoy the outdoors, but it takes a beating from the elements. The sun, rain, and wind can all damage the straps that hold the furniture together. If the straps are damaged, the furniture may become unsafe or uncomfortable to use. Fortunately, repairing patio furniture straps is a relatively easy and inexpensive process.

The first step is to identify what type of straps you need to repair. Patio furniture straps are typically made of webbing, vinyl, or nylon. Webbing straps are the most common type, and they are made of a strong, durable material that is resistant to weathering. Vinyl straps are also durable, but they are not as breathable as webbing straps. Nylon straps are the most expensive type, but they are also the most durable and comfortable.

Once you have identified the type of straps you need to repair, you can begin the repair process. If the straps are simply loose, you can tighten them by using a pair of pliers to crimp the metal rings that hold them in place. If the straps are damaged, you will need to replace them. To replace the straps, you will need to remove the old straps and then sew the new straps in place.

To remove the old straps, you will need to use a pair of pliers to cut the metal rings that hold them in place. Once the rings are cut, you can pull the old straps off of the furniture. To sew the new straps in place, you will need to use a heavy-duty needle and thread. Start by sewing the straps to the frame of the furniture. Once the straps are sewn to the frame, you can sew the straps together to create a loop. Make sure to use a strong knot to secure the ends of the straps.

Once the straps are sewn in place, you can reattach the metal rings. To do this, you will need to use a pair of pliers to crimp the rings around the straps. Make sure to crimp the rings tightly to secure the straps in place.

Once the straps are repaired, you can enjoy your patio furniture again. By following these simple steps, you can keep your patio furniture looking its best for years to come.
